I wouldn't necessary say it''s deeper, but it does hand to hand better. There are more actual moves (instead of gadets,) in Sleeping dogs. Wei is also a lot weaker than Batman and this makes combat more challenging. Also...it has more fun variety in enemies to me. With Batman special enemies (shields, stun batons etc) required specific technique..one for each, without any variety. In Sleeping Dogs you've got graplers and heavy hitters, but they can be beaten with multiple hand to hand techiques. Also..the enviorement is cruicial in Sleeping Dogs fights, while bassicaly completely meaningless in AC. Plus you've got psychological effects on combat in SD. if you break somebody's legs or arms the other enemies react with visible fear.
Overall I find Sleeping Dogs combat to be much clunkier and less polished, but it's a lot more satysfying when it comes to pure hand to hand combat, as it simply is more varied and allows you do more. Of course, Batman has all his gadtets that spice things up and opening attacks from above, but you could just as well throw firearms and vehicular combat into Sleeping Dog's advantages then.
